From 05ca9610bec77eeea9ba58b4171a938727ace62a Mon Sep 17 00:00:00 2001 From: dukenv0307 Date: Wed, 28 Feb 2024 16:22:02 +0700 Subject: [PATCH] Fix display name displays twice on LHN after receiving payment --- src/libs/SidebarUtils.ts |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/src/libs/SidebarUtils.ts b/src/libs/SidebarUtils.ts index 35cf52a5ff99..d8b0ed90309e 100644 --- a/src/libs/SidebarUtils.ts +++ b/src/libs/SidebarUtils.ts @@ -289,14 +289,12 @@ function getOptionData({ let lastMessageText = lastMessageTextFromReport; - const reportAction = lastReportActions?.[report.reportID]; + const lastAction = visibleReportActionItems[report.reportID]; const isThreadMessage = - ReportUtils.isThread(report) && reportAction?.actionName === CONST.REPORT.ACTIONS.TYPE.ADDCOMMENT && reportAction?.pendingAction !== CONST.RED_BRICK_ROAD_PENDING_ACTION.DELETE; + ReportUtils.isThread(report) && lastAction?.actionName === CONST.REPORT.ACTIONS.TYPE.ADDCOMMENT && lastAction?.pendingAction !== CONST.RED_BRICK_ROAD_PENDING_ACTION.DELETE; if ((result.isChatRoom || result.isPolicyExpenseChat || result.isThread || result.isTaskReport || isThreadMessage) && !result.isArchivedRoom) { - const lastAction = visibleReportActionItems[report.reportID]; - if (lastAction?.actionName === CONST.REPORT.ACTIONS.TYPE.RENAMED) { const newName = lastAction?.originalMessage?.newName ?? ''; result.alternateText = Localize.translate(preferredLocale, 'newRoomPage.roomRenamedTo', {newName});